Checklist
- Request batch photographs and a packing list prior to shipment.
- Retain one sealed sample carton from every batch for reference.
- Keep certificates current and filed against the exact model name.
- Check carton quantities against the commercial invoice line by line.
- Log sell through by account for the first eight weeks.
- Agree in advance who pays for return freight on a defect claim.

Frequently asked questions
Should a Max Air distributorship be exclusive?
Only against a defined volume commitment; open terms with a review point are safer for a first year.
Is documentation provided for customs?
Commercial invoice, packing list and the relevant certificates are supplied; the importer's broker handles the declaration.
Can packaging be adjusted for our market?
Artwork localisation is straightforward; structural changes need larger volumes and a longer lead time.
Do you support long term supply agreements?
Yes, rolling agreements with defined review points work better for both sides than rigid annual commitments.
